mirror of
https://github.com/signalapp/Signal-Android.git
synced 2026-04-30 05:31:34 +01:00
Update and centralize block strings.
This commit is contained in:
@@ -80,6 +80,7 @@ import org.greenrobot.eventbus.EventBus;
|
||||
import org.greenrobot.eventbus.Subscribe;
|
||||
import org.greenrobot.eventbus.ThreadMode;
|
||||
import org.thoughtcrime.securesms.ApplicationContext;
|
||||
import org.thoughtcrime.securesms.BlockUnblockDialog;
|
||||
import org.thoughtcrime.securesms.ExpirationDialog;
|
||||
import org.thoughtcrime.securesms.GroupCreateActivity;
|
||||
import org.thoughtcrime.securesms.GroupMembersDialog;
|
||||
@@ -1680,7 +1681,7 @@ public class ConversationActivity extends PassphraseRequiredActionBarActivity
|
||||
composeText.setOnClickListener(composeKeyPressedListener);
|
||||
composeText.setOnFocusChangeListener(composeKeyPressedListener);
|
||||
|
||||
if (getPackageManager().hasSystemFeature(PackageManager.FEATURE_CAMERA) && Camera.getNumberOfCameras() > 0) {
|
||||
if (Camera.getNumberOfCameras() > 0) {
|
||||
quickCameraToggle.setVisibility(View.VISIBLE);
|
||||
quickCameraToggle.setOnClickListener(new QuickCameraToggleListener());
|
||||
} else {
|
||||
@@ -2940,20 +2941,7 @@ public class ConversationActivity extends PassphraseRequiredActionBarActivity
|
||||
return;
|
||||
}
|
||||
|
||||
AlertDialog.Builder builder = new AlertDialog.Builder(this)
|
||||
.setNeutralButton(R.string.ConversationActivity_cancel, (d, w) -> d.dismiss())
|
||||
.setPositiveButton(R.string.ConversationActivity_block_and_delete, (d, w) -> requestModel.onBlockAndDelete())
|
||||
.setNegativeButton(R.string.ConversationActivity_block, (d, w) -> requestModel.onBlock());
|
||||
|
||||
if (recipient.isGroup()) {
|
||||
builder.setTitle(getString(R.string.ConversationActivity_block_and_leave_s, recipient.getDisplayName(this)));
|
||||
builder.setMessage(R.string.ConversationActivity_you_will_leave_this_group_and_no_longer_receive_messages_or_updates);
|
||||
} else {
|
||||
builder.setTitle(getString(R.string.ConversationActivity_block_s, recipient.getDisplayName(this)));
|
||||
builder.setMessage(R.string.ConversationActivity_blocked_people_will_not_be_able_to_call_you_or_send_you_messages);
|
||||
}
|
||||
|
||||
builder.show();
|
||||
BlockUnblockDialog.showBlockAndDeleteFor(this, getLifecycle(), recipient, requestModel::onBlock, requestModel::onBlockAndDelete);
|
||||
}
|
||||
|
||||
private void onMessageRequestUnblockClicked(@NonNull MessageRequestViewModel requestModel) {
|
||||
@@ -2963,18 +2951,7 @@ public class ConversationActivity extends PassphraseRequiredActionBarActivity
|
||||
return;
|
||||
}
|
||||
|
||||
AlertDialog.Builder builder = new AlertDialog.Builder(this)
|
||||
.setTitle(getString(R.string.ConversationActivity_unblock_s, recipient.getDisplayName(this)))
|
||||
.setNeutralButton(R.string.ConversationActivity_cancel, (d, w) -> d.dismiss())
|
||||
.setNegativeButton(R.string.ConversationActivity_unblock, (d, w) -> requestModel.onUnblock());
|
||||
|
||||
if (recipient.isGroup()) {
|
||||
builder.setMessage(R.string.ConversationActivity_group_members_will_be_able_to_add_you_to_this_group_again);
|
||||
} else {
|
||||
builder.setMessage(R.string.ConversationActivity_you_will_be_able_to_message_and_call_each_other);
|
||||
}
|
||||
|
||||
builder.show();
|
||||
BlockUnblockDialog.showUnblockFor(this, getLifecycle(), recipient, requestModel::onUnblock);
|
||||
}
|
||||
|
||||
private void presentMessageRequestDisplayState(@NonNull MessageRequestViewModel.DisplayState displayState) {
|
||||
|
||||
Reference in New Issue
Block a user